If you can open a socket to a server
then you can open one to an HTTP server
and send a GET url
the HTTP server is a socket server + handler for the HTTP protocol.
In Tachyon for example you can just take the EASYMAIL code and change it to connect to a Webserver.
Then send the request.
The SPIN / SPINNERET code should be able to do this as well.
At least the W5100 provides all that is needed.
